§ 46.3. Transfer of surplus funds accruing to General Revenue Fund for 2007
A. On July 1, 2007, or as soon thereafter as feasible, the Office of Management and Enterprise Services shall transfer the following amounts of surplus funds which accrue to the General Revenue Fund of the State of Oklahoma for the fiscal year ending June 30, 2007, over and above that which is placed in the Constitutional Reserve Fund pursuant to Section 23 of Article X of the Constitution of the State of Oklahoma for the fiscal year ending June 30, 2007:
1. The first Ten Million Dollars ($10,000,000.00) to the following entities in order to provide funding for the incremental revenues necessary to fund the employer contribution rate increases prescribed by Section 17-108.1 of Title 70 of the Oklahoma Statutes resulting from the enactment of Enrolled Senate Bill No. 357 of the 1st Session of the 51st Oklahoma Legislature:
a. Nineteen Million Nine Hundred Fifty-three Thousand One Hundred Thirty-three Dollars ($19,953,133.00) to the State Board of Education to transfer to the appropriate dispensing fund for teacher salary increases as provided for in Enrolled House Bill No. 1134 of the 1st Session of the Oklahoma Legislature. These funds shall be distributed in the same manner as funds appropriated to the State Board of Education for the financial support of public schools,
b. One Million Seventy-three Thousand Six Hundred Four Dollars ($1,073,604.00) to the State Board of Education to transfer to the appropriate dispensing fund shall be used to implement the Science and Mathematics Advanced Recruiting Technique Program which shall provide incentives for the employment of persons in the common schools of the state who have advanced degrees in science, mathematics or both such disciplines,
7. The next Five Million Five Hundred Thousand Dollars ($5,500,000.00) to the Department of Public Safety Revolving Fund for a study of the feasibility of implementing a statewide interoperable communications system and for capital expenditures necessary to upgrade and maintain the existing statewide emergency communications system;
10. The next Six Million Dollars ($6,000,000.00) to the Research Support Revolving Fund of the Oklahoma Center for the Advancement of Science and Technology to provide funding for an Oklahoma Bioenergy Center involving collaborative efforts among Oklahoma State University, the University of Oklahoma and a private foundation. The amount authorized by this paragraph shall be allocated equally between the two universities;
11. The next One Million Eight Hundred Thousand Dollars ($1,800,000.00) to the State Regents Revolving Fund of the Oklahoma State Regents for Higher Education for purposes of capital expenditures for the Langston University campus if such amount is utilized to match federal monies available through the United States Department of Agriculture;
23. The next Fifty Thousand Dollars ($50,000.00) to the Office of Juvenile Affairs Revolving Fund of the Office of Juvenile Affairs for the Oklahoma Statewide Gang Intervention Steering Committee as created pursuant to Enrolled House Bill No. 1760 of the 1st Session of the 51st Oklahoma Legislature.
